The radius of gyration and second virial coefficient of a sample of polystyrene dissolved in cyclohexane were measured at a series of temperatures with the following results T/K 305.7 | 307.2 | 311.2 | 318.2 | 328.2 Rg/nm | 47.9 51.8 57.6 62.5 66.5 B -0.40 -0.20 0.37 0.95 1.58 Estimate the unperturbed root mean square end-to-end distance (empirically) and the O temperature in this solvent. Ro = 130 nm; T = 308 K
